During this new year—let’s be mythbusters!

Let’s lay to rest forever the myth that we cannot do anything creative for God.  Destroy the myth.  Blow it to smithereens (whatever smithereens are).

What could be more inanimate and less creative than a rock?  A rock can’t sing.  Boulders cannot play basketball.  Pebbles will never give a speech.  We can skip a rock, but a rock can’t skip.  Yet Christ chose a rock to demonstrate what He can do through anything which serves Him.  When the Pharisees told Him to silence His disciples He replied, “I tell you, if they keep quiet, the stones will cry out.” (Luke 19:40).

The stones will cry out.  Rocks will praise Him.  Pebbles will serve Him.  Lumps of clay will become vessels of honor.  Wait a minute—that’s what the Apostle Paul said in Romans 9:21.  The Apostle Peter called us “living stones” and said our job is to offer “spiritual sacrifices acceptable to God” (I Peter 2:5).

My father kept six cans of rocks turning constantly in our garage, each with a different consistency of grit.  The end goal of the finished rock-tumbling was beautiful polished agates and other gemstones perfect for use in jewelry.  Our Father desires to polish each one of us into precious gemstones “fit for the master’s use” (II Timothy 2:21).
